Abstract
Thin rhodamin B dye layers were deposited on gas-evaporated GaP particle layers and their fluorescence intensities were compared with those of the dye layers simultaneously deposited onto glass substrates. The intensities of the dye layers on the GaP particle layers were found to be greatly enhanced and the enhancement factor increased from ∼10 to ∼140 as the thickness of the dye layer is decreased from ∼50 to ∼1 nm. The present results clearly demonstrate that GaP particle layers, although they are not metallic and do not support surface plasmons, are good enhancer of fluorescence free from quenching.
